最近我也遇到过:TP钱包提币一直停在“打包中”,像卡在门口进不去。最开始我以为是网络慢,后来才发现更像是链上在做“入场检票”:数字签名核验、交易打包排队、合约回执确认……只要任意一环没对上,用户就只能看着那四个字干等。
先说数字签名。很多人把“打包中”理解成“矿工还没打”,但本质是:你的交易先要完成签名并被网络验证。签名不是随便生成的,它相当于你对这笔转账内容的“不可抵赖签字”。如果签名参数、nonce(交易序号)或账户状态与链上预期不一致,就可能导致交易无法被正确纳入后续处理队列,于是反复显示打包中。尤其在你频繁操作、同时发起多笔提币时,更容易出现nonce错位或钱包端重试策略触发“排队感”。

再聊DAI。你在提币时如果涉及DAI相关路径(例如通过某些路由交换后再提、或链上代币合约交互中出现DAI),会牵扯到合约层的校验与状态读取。DAI通常是有完善的合约逻辑与状态依赖的资产,一旦你选择的交易路径需要读取储备、额度或授权状态,就可能出现“看似交易已发出,但还在等合约返回值”的情况。很多时候真正卡住的不是网络,而是合约返回值还没被你这笔交易的执行结果“确认”。
这就引出实时数据管理。TP钱包不是单纯把交易丢到链上就结束,它还要管理状态:交易广播成功、链上确认次数、gas价格动态变化、以及可能的重组(reorg)风险。实时数据管理做得越细,你看到的“打包中”就越像是系统在持续刷新信息,而不是假死。若钱包端的本地缓存过旧、或对节点返回的延迟估计偏差,界面就可能出现“长期打包中”但链上其实已经完成,只是回执同步没及时。

更进一步,是智能化生态系统。我们常说web3是去中心化,但用户体验背后其实离不开“智能化生态系统”:钱包对接多个节点、路由策略自动切换、对拥堵状态进行预测、甚至在不同链或不同合约交互方式之间做取舍。你觉得自己在等“打包”,其实钱包在用一套规则系统尽量让交易按你期望的方式完成。
说到合约返回值,很多人会忽略这一点:即使交易被打包,如果合约执行失败或返回的关键字段不符合预期,钱包也会继续显示等待确认。比如授权不足、参数格式不对、或路由合约没拿到中间步骤所需的状态,它可能返回错误码或空结果,钱包就会把它归入“待最终结果”。此时你会发现哈希在,但就是不“放行”。
那市场前景呢?我反而觉得这是好现象。因为随着DeFi与多链应用普及,用户对“可解释的交易状态”需求会越来越强。未来钱包会更像“交易教练”,把打包中拆成:签名完成、排队中、执行中、回执已确认,并把https://www.jianghuixinrong.com ,失败原因用更友好的方式呈现。只要这种透明度提升,市场对链上资产的信任会进一步增强。
我自己的建议是:别只盯着“打包中”。先检查交易哈希是否已存在、确认网络选择是否正确;必要时在钱包里查看详细状态,看是否涉及DAI或合约交互失败;同时留意授权与gas策略。等真正看清链上每一步,你就会从“焦虑等待”变成“有把握处理”。
评论
NovaRiver
我也是一直打包中,后来发现其实是回执同步慢了。看了详情才知道合约返回值早就OK,只是钱包没刷新。
小竹影
提DAI相关时更容易出现这种状态吧?我上次授权没点全,交易哈希有但一直没放行。
ChainWarden
数字签名+nonce错位真的会坑到人。尤其频繁提币时,别连续猛点,等上笔状态更稳。
LunaByte
实时数据管理很关键,我同一笔在不同手机钱包里显示不一样。换个节点或刷新后就好。
雨后星尘
作者说到合约返回值我才懂了:打包了≠执行成功。界面提示得再清楚点就好了。
MangoOrbit
市场前景我同意,钱包未来应该像“解释器”,把排队/执行/确认拆开讲,别再让人只看四个字干等。